Device files missing.
All the ather disks, most also from my xp512, have device files.
This machine is in a 3 node cluster and onm the other two machines I do not have this problem.

Re: Device files missing.
You can recreate device files by:
# insf -e
This will check entire system and will create device files if needed.

Re: Device files missing.
run insf -e -H
This will create files specifically for devices under the H/W path.
